Residential stair-only move
Scenario: third-floor apartment with narrow stairs and a king-size bed. Approach: disassemble what is practical, prioritize protective wrapping, use specialized lifting straps and corner guards. Outcome: move completed in a single morning using a two-person crew plus coordinator.

Scenario: 12-person office moving with minimal downtime. Approach: inventory critical equipment, schedule phased transfers outside core hours, pre-label all workstations, and stage cabling. Outcome: reduced operational interruption by moving non-critical furniture first and IT last.

Scenario: upright piano and antique armoire needing secure transport. Approach: custom crating, route survey for door and hallway widths, and two-point lifting. Outcome: transit with minimal vibration and documented condition report on delivery.
